2014 Ford Fiesta SE EcoBoost Review Official TrueDelta review by Michael Karesh The Fiesta's compliant suspension isn't without a cost. The steering and suspension feel a touch squishy, even mildly tippy, on center. Push through the initial squish, though, and both systems firm up nicely, delivering reassuring feedback and control. 2012 Honda Fit Pros and Cons Member4778 Nimble and responsive. Have yet to feel the VSC kick-in with 8/10 levels of aggressive driving. On the highway the wheel weights up nicely relative to speed. Even lets you kick out the tail a little at the limit before it plows. Corners flatly. |

2009 Honda Fit Pros and Cons Member3886 I can toss the Fit into just about any corner and she handles it like a dream. Steering is firm and responsive with good feedback. Typical FWD under steer is still apparent but not terribly so. |
